I am a newbie to NGS.We are evaluating the possibility of doing CNV analysis by NGS data eigher by Illumina MiSeq or Ion PGM platform on archived melanoma FFPE sample. We donot want high cycle PCR involved in the protocol which may saturate the result. But both Illumina (targetd enrichment) and Ion PGM protocol (template preparation) include high cycle PCR. Does anyone have a good idea? Thanks.
